JAVA程序设计基础实验1

实 验 报 告 一课 程JAVA程序设计实验项目Java语言基础成 绩学 号XXXXXXXX姓 名 XXXX实验日期2012-9-17专业班级计算机科学与技术(嵌入式方向)指导教师XXX一【实验目的】(1)了解Java程序的结构及特点 (2)熟悉Java语言的开发与运行环境(3)掌握Java数据类型、语句和表达式(4)掌握Java运算符及数据类型转换(5)掌握Java控制语句二【实验内容】 【项目一】完成实验指导书P2——1.2.1 一个简单的应用程序。class A{ void f(){ System.out.println("We are student"); }}class B{}public class Hello{ public static void main (String args[]){ System.out.println("你好,很高兴学习Java"); A a=new A(); a.f(); }}

【项目二】完成实验指导书P6——1.3 联合编译

【项目三】完成实验指导书P14——3.2.1猜数字随机分配给客户一个1~100之间的整数用户从键盘输入自己的猜测程序返回提示信息,提示信息分别是“猜大了”、“猜小了”和“猜对了”用户可根据提示信息再次输入猜测,指导提示信息是“猜对了”(1)程序代码 import java.util.*;

public class test2{ public static void main (String args[]) { System.out.println("给你一个1至100之间的整数,请猜测这个数"); int a =(int)(Math.random()*100)+1; int b=0; Scanner reader=new Scanner(System.in); System.out.println("输入您的猜测:"); b=reader.nextInt(); while(b!=a) { if(b>a) { System.out.println("猜大了"); b=reader.nextInt(); } else if(b

(2)运行结果 截图

【项目四】数组 编写一个Java 程序,定义一个2行3列的整型二维数组,对数组中的每个元素赋值一个0~100的随机整数,然后分别对第一行、第二行的元素排序。(1)程序代码 import java.util.* ;

public class Array{ public static void main(String args[]){ int i,j,k,temp; int a[][]=new int[2][3]; a[0][0]=18; a[0][1]=92; a[0][2]=1; a[1][0]=90; a[1][1]=41; a[1][2]=82; for(j=0;j<3;j++) System.out.println("a[0]["+j+"]="+a[0][j]); System.out.println(" "); for(j=0;j<3;j++) System.out.println("a[1]["+j+"]="+a[1][j]); System.out.println(" "); for(i=0;i<2;i++){ for(j=0;j<2;j

java程序设计基础实验_JAVA程序设计基础实验1.doc相关推荐

  1. java红牛农场答案_Java面向对象程序设计实验指导与习题解答(21世纪高等学校计算机专业实用规划教材)...

    导语 <Java面向对象程序设计实验指导与习题解答>是<Java面向对象程序设计>(作者耿祥义,清华大学出版社出版,2010)的配套实验指导和习题解答,目的是通过一系列实验练习 ...

  2. java红牛农场答案_Java面向对象程序设计实验指导与习题解答

    第1章 java入门 实验1一个简单的应用程序 实验2教室.教师和学生 实验答案 第2章 基本数据类型 实验1输出特殊偏旁的汉字 实验2输入.输出学生的基本信息 实验3超大整数的加法 实验答案 第3章 ...

  3. java语言执行过程_Java程序的运行过程(执行流程)分析

    万事知其然,要知其所以然,所以本节带大家来详细了解一下 Java 程序的执行过程.从<使用记事本编写运行Java程序>一节的案例可以看出,Java 程序的运行必须经过编写.编译和运行 3 ...

  4. java素数的流程图_Java程序流程结构

    版权声明:以上文章中所选用的图片及文字来源于网络以及用户投稿,由于未联系到知识产权人或未发现有关知识产权的登记,如有知识产权人并不愿意我们使用,如果有侵权请立即联系:55525090@qq.com,我 ...

  5. java斗图表情_java程序员斗图表情包 为何总是输

    原标题:java程序员斗图表情包 为何总是输 程序员之间的斗图表情包, java真的输惨了! 表情包成了人与人聊天中不可少的分量,陌生人聊天表情包丢出去妥妥的拉近关系变熟络啊(¬_¬) 而且可以用表情 ...

  6. java程序设计基础实验_java程序设计基础实验答案

    [单选] 燃烧室的构成不包括(). [单选] 常用的螺纹防松装置不包括(). [单选] GK1C型内燃机车主车架长度为()mm. [单选] ()转向架设有手制动装置,基础制动装置右侧水平杠杆装有联结钢 ...

  7. java界面编辑教程_java程序设计基础教程第六章图形用户界面编辑.docx

    java程序设计基础教程第六章图形用户界面编辑.docx 还剩 27页未读, 继续阅读 下载文档到电脑,马上远离加班熬夜! 亲,很抱歉,此页已超出免费预览范围啦! 如果喜欢就下载吧,价低环保! 内容要 ...

  8. java程序设计基础篇_java程序设计基础篇 复习笔记 第一单元

    java语言程序设计基础篇笔记 1. 几种有名的语言 COBOL:商业应用 FORTRAN:数学运算 BASIC:易学易用 Visual Basic,Delphi:图形用户界面 C:汇编语言的强大功能 ...

  9. java程序设计 郑莉_Java程序设计基础-清华大学-计算机科学与技术-郑莉教授-学堂在线-第一章...

    旁听课程记录 一.Java语言基础知识 1.机器语言  汇编语言   高级语言  { 面向过程的高级语言(C).面向对象的高级语言(Java_1995)} 2.面向对象语言的基本特征: 抽象和封装.继 ...

最新文章

  1. 公众号24小时自动吸粉秘密!一次推广终身有客户
  2. 2017/5 JavaScript基础4--- 表达式、运算符
  3. C# App.config全攻略
  4. Linux学习笔记6
  5. 从零写一个编译器(二):语法分析之前置知识
  6. 设计模式4-创建型模式-Prototype模式
  7. 普通笔记本能运行Linux么,Windows ARM 笔记本电脑现在可以运行 Ubuntu
  8. 为你的应用程序添加动态Java代码
  9. 【英语学习】【Level 07】U02 Live Work L2 A place to call my home
  10. 哪个相机可以拍gif动图_入门级微单相机哪家强?索尼微单A6400评测来了!
  11. Selenium自动化测试WebDriver下载
  12. content=IE=edge,chrome=1的meta标签内容
  13. libmodbus使用
  14. 【day4】【洛谷算法题】-P5708三角形面积-刷题反思集[入门1顺序结构]
  15. 梧桐树金玉满堂增额终身寿险将下架,百度开屏也懂我的资产荒焦虑
  16. Matlab(2)基本操作与矩阵输入
  17. Python动画制作:90秒倒计时圆形进度条效果
  18. 信息熵--硬币称重问题-详解
  19. magic和android的区别,荣耀Magic缺点是什么?荣耀Magic优缺点一览
  20. ESP8266-12F NodeMCU、MG90S舵机、Arduino IDE——制作家庭自用远程开关(手机遥控-仅关灯)

热门文章

  1. PySpark RDD操作
  2. 32款网页设计开发人员必备的谷歌浏览器扩展
  3. [Pyhon大数据分析] 五.人民网新闻话题抓取及Gephi构建主题知识图谱
  4. 企业怎么制作网站?怎么制作网站教程步骤
  5. 互联网日报 | 3月23日 星期二 | 京东集团8亿美元增持达达集团;阿里云盘正式启动公测;快手进军二手电商...
  6. 机器人螺栓拆装_一种带电作业机器人专用螺栓拆装固定装置的制作方法
  7. 【苦练基本功】代码整洁之道 pt1(第1章-第3章)
  8. jstack 命令使用经验总结和线程性能诊断脚本
  9. 设置固定IP后无法上网
  10. Java 抛出异常【throw】